What does the Bible say about loving salvation?

Answered in 2 sources

The Bible teaches that true believers love God's salvation, recognizing it as His gift and work in their lives.

The scriptures highlight the importance of loving God's salvation as an essential characteristic of true believers. In Psalm 70:4, we see that those who love God's salvation are called to rejoice and continually magnify the Lord. This love for salvation isn't merely a passive acknowledgment; it's an active pursuit fueled by an awareness of our need for Christ. Believers seek Him sincerely and earnestly because they recognize that salvation is not merely an offer God makes, but a divine gift that He gives to whom He wills, illustrating God's grace and sovereignty in salvation.
Scripture References: Psalm 70:4, Philippians 3:10, Jeremiah 29:11-14, Psalm 40:16
